Every car will be different. It will depend on the plugs you use, the fuel, etc. Do as Mr 5 0 said and advance it and drive up a hill in a high enough gear to really bog it down with the gas pedal floored. If you hear the pinging you've gone too far. It will be loud enough you will hear it assuming you don't have your radio cranked. That will be good enough to get the maximum amount of timing out of your car and be on the safe side if you back it off 2 degrees after it starts pinging.

But really, 16 degrees is plenty.

That 32 degrees of timing may be someone who is reading it without pulling the spout connector out and they are getting a bogus reading or they are quoting base timing before the computer takes over? They are probably actually getting around 12-14 degrees or so I'm guessing. I could be wrong as hell :P
